Acer Aspire 5630 dvd writer problem. Please help.

Hi All

I have an Acer Aspire 5630 Laptop with Wndows Vista Home Premium. When I put a disk into the DVD drive it dosn't read it and the drive itself is not showing up on "Computer". Im not sure if I have deleted the drivers by accident or they have just vanished?

Can anyone please help? In device manager there are two little yelow triangles with exclamation marks in them. I have tried updating the driver software in device manager but it says the drivers are upto date?? I have also tried uninstalling the drivers in device manager and restarting the computer to allow them to reinstall automatically. When the laptop restarts a window pops up that says:

"Error reading TrayIcon1 -> Visible: Cannot Create System Shell Notification Icon" to which I have to click "ok" to allow the system to carry on reloading.

Next in the bottom right hand corner a box pops up saying installing new drivers. I click on it to watch the progress. It then says that both drivers have failed.

The drivers are called:

"MagicISO Virtual DVD-ROM0000"

and

"PIONEER DVD-RW DVR-K17RS ATA Device"

I have searched the net to try and find a reliable source for these and have had no luck. The Acer website does not appear to have them so I am completly stuck on what to do next???

Is my DVD writer broken or do I need to reinstall the drivers that I can not find???
